On March 16th, Iowa State Cyclones earned a number-two seed in the Midwest region for the 2026 NCAA tournament. As an at-large BIC-12 team, they'll face the Tennessee State Tigers in their opener on March 20th at 2.50pm Eastern Time. CBS Sports analyst Matt Norlander ranked the cyclones sixth overall among all 68 tournament teams. That puts them just behind powerhouses like Arizona, Michigan, Duke, Houston, and Florida reflecting their strong 27-win 7-loss regular season. The team built a solid resume with big road wins over Purdue by 23 points, plus victories against St. John's Texas Tech, Houston, and Kansas. Coach T.J. Otzelberger has them playing like contenders when they're clicking. Their big three leads the charge, Joshua Jefferson on all BIC-12 first team averaging nearly 20 points, 10 rebounds, and more in the conference tournament.
